Node.js CircleCI在fs额外节点_模块处失败

Node.js CircleCI在fs额外节点_模块处失败,node.js,cypress,circleci,docsy,Node.js,Cypress,Circleci,Docsy,我一直在做一个项目,最近,在Circle CI管道中,我开始出现这个错误 /root/project/node_modules/fs-extra/lib/mkdirs/make-dir.js:85 } catch { ^ SyntaxError: Unexpected token { at createScript (vm.js:80:10) at Object.runInThisContext (vm.js:139:10) at Module.

我一直在做一个项目,最近,在Circle CI管道中,我开始出现这个错误

/root/project/node_modules/fs-extra/lib/mkdirs/make-dir.js:85
  } catch {
          ^

SyntaxError: Unexpected token {
    at createScript (vm.js:80:10)
    at Object.runInThisContext (vm.js:139:10)
    at Module._compile (module.js:617:28)
    at Object.Module._extensions..js (module.js:664:10)
    at Module.load (module.js:566:32)
    at tryModuleLoad (module.js:506:12)
    at Function.Module._load (module.js:498:3)
    at Module.require (module.js:597:17)
    at require (internal/module.js:11:18)
    at Object.<anonymous> (/root/project/node_modules/fs-extra/lib/mkdirs/index.js:3:44)
    at Module._compile (module.js:653:30)
    at Object.Module._extensions..js (module.js:664:10)
    at Module.load (module.js:566:32)
    at tryModuleLoad (module.js:506:12)
    at Function.Module._load (module.js:498:3)
    at Module.require (module.js:597:17)
/root/project/node_modules/fs extra/lib/mkdirs/make dir.js:85
}抓住{
^
SyntaxError:意外标记{
在createScript上(vm.js:80:10)
在Object.runInThisContext(vm.js:139:10)
在模块处编译(Module.js:617:28)
在Object.Module.\u extensions..js(Module.js:664:10)
在Module.load(Module.js:566:32)
在tryModuleLoad时(module.js:506:12)
在Function.Module.\u加载(Module.js:498:3)
at Module.require(Module.js:597:17)
根据需要(内部/module.js:11:18)
反对

nodejs
版本是12.16.1 fs额外版本是9.0.1,在这种情况下,它被称为^9.0.0


有人知道这个错误是从哪里来的,以及如何修复它吗?我似乎与我的节点版本(超过v10)和fs extra保持一致。我宁愿不降级,除非它是唯一的atm解决方案。

你知道这一点吗?谢谢!不幸的是,我对这个问题没有最新的想法。